Required Practical : Hooke's Law

Cards (2)

  • What is the method of the Hooke's Law?
    1. Measure starting length of spring using a ruler when no load is applied.
    2. Add a marker at the bottom of the spring to make reading more accurate
    3. Add a mass to spring, allow it to come to rest and measure the new length
    4. Calculate the extension(change in length)
    5. Repeat until you have at least 6 measurements
    6. Remember to use the same spring made of the same material if you repeat or compare readings
